// Fixture: slim-image regression guard for Marlinet workers.
// Builds `marlinet-slim` and asserts the final layer stays under
// 180 MB with curl, tzdata, and the healthcheck binary intact.
// If this fails at 3 a.m., it's almost always an upstream base
// image bump — pin it and page no one else. The fixture pulls
// from the staging registry using the bearer token below.

session JWT of yawep-yawep = eyJhbGciOiJIUzI1NiIsInR5cCI6IkpXVCJ9.eyJzdWIiOiI3pWF3_In0.aXYsHiog

## Local setup

Glacierhop handlers cold-start slowly if the emulator warms on demand. Pre-warm before testing: run the warmup script, wait for all six handlers to report ready, then invoke. Skipping this inflates latency numbers and makes release benchmarks useless. The emulator needs the runtime image pulled locally and port 7810 free. Handlers read feature flags at init, so changes require a restart, not a redeploy. State persists in the local metadata database; the emulator picks it up automatically from the string below:

replica DSN, kajep-yahag: mssql://praok_svc:iF@db-8d68.plorvaio.local:5432/eliion

Handover note — Crumbwheel order cutoffs.

Welcome aboard. The bakery cutoff rule in Crumbwheel closes same-day orders at 14:00 local to each storefront, not UTC — this has bitten us twice. Holiday overrides live in the calendar service and take precedence silently, so always check there first when a cutoff looks wrong. To unlock the calendar service's admin console after a restart, enter the recovery passphrase below.

vault phrase of bagap-bahaf = silion-pelox-sorox-casdor-quenwyn-fraax-eliox-praael-kelion-quenvan-kasox-rusael-norius-belvan